Frankfurter with Emmental Cheese Calories

385kcal
per serving (1 sosisi (~110 g))
350kcal
per 100 g

Enjoy a satisfying Frankfurter paired with the nutty flavor of Emmental cheese for a quick and flavorful meal.

Macronutrients

100 gServing
Protein15 g16.5 g
Carbs2 g2.2 g
Fat32 g35.2 g
Fiber0 g0.0 g

Benefits

This hearty Frankfurter with Emmental cheese offers a good source of protein, essential for muscle maintenance and satiety. Its rich flavor makes it a convenient option for a fulfilling meal.

Watch out for

This food contains gluten, milk, and soy, which are common allergens. Individuals with sensitivities or allergies to these ingredients should consume with caution.

How to fit it into your diet

Due to its fat content, this Frankfurter with Emmental cheese is best enjoyed in moderation as part of a balanced diet. Consider it for an occasional lunch when seeking a protein-rich option.

Dietitian’s note

While a good source of protein, this Frankfurter with Emmental cheese is also high in fat. It can be incorporated into a weight management plan, but portion control is key. Pair it with plenty of vegetables to enhance its nutritional value.
